                                            I have had a read carefully through the FAQs Chris linked to and have a few questions below that I would like clarified if he has the time.

                                            @Chris, Fair enough about the above 'nominal support reinstatement fee (TBD)'. As stated, we shall see.

                                            From the FAQs

                                            %(#0000BF)[*I just want the new version and not support. Can I pay less than the $95?

                                            Support can’t be broken out from our new upgrade, maintenance, and support program. Of course, you don’t have to use support if you don’t want to. There are many resources available online which can help resolve nearly any question you have about SketchUp; we certainly encourage you to use those tools. The upgrade, maintenance, and support program costs as much as our old upgrades used to cost, but now we are including any additional major version upgrades that become available while you’re actively in the program.*]

                                            I think it should go without saying that one does no have to use (TSU) support if one does not want to. However I would question that TSU actually has the resources to make this kind of a support guarantee in he first place. While I am not privy to the actual number of existing Pro licenses, From keeping my ear to the ground and doing some math, I imagine that it runs into the millions and TSU would be expecting / hoping for large numbers of Upgrades also new 2013 sales.

                                            My question is does TSU really have the numbers that would be needed in a support team that could actually deliver proper support to the possibly envisaged figures? If so, I think you will need to extend the office quickly. Then again, there is always remote support. But support is support and involves one person talking via phone, Skype, Hangout etc to another person. I doubt automation could as yet cover this requirement.

                                            On the other hand the above mentions, There are many resources available online which can help resolve nearly any question you have about SketchUp; we certainly encourage you to use those tools. Could you briefly list here also on the FAQs the actual 'tools' you are referring to. I think that should be very useful to potential customers and most reasonable.

                                            %(#0000BF)[*What happens if I decide to skip a year in this program?

                                            SketchUp Pro commercial licenses never expire, so skipping a year of the program doesn’t affect your use of SketchUp Pro at all. However, if you do decide to skip a year, you can expect a modest reinstatement fee should you choose to renew your upgrade, maintenance, and support program.*]

                                            Again, I think the 'modest reinstatement fee' should be stated. This is what I was talking about in my earlier post ...... a little more 'upfrontness' would not go astray and actually be more respected. I feel these costs / figures should be worked out well in advance of launch stage.
